Picked her up a little later than originally planned. The weather didn't cooperate and we ran out of daylight before I could get many pics but here's what I can tell so far.

The hull is solid and looks very good for its age. The trailer is outstanding. It's a 2000 model year with surge brakes and a nice strap winch.

The sole seems solid but we'll wait and see when the astro turf comes up.

The engine is a Volvo Penta fresh water cooled AQ125 mated to a 280 drive. Anybody know what block this is? Anyway, seems to be in better than average condition. Seller says it runs but it won't turn over from the key switch, a jump across the solenoid and it does turn. No time to try to fire it up today. Hopefully I can get to it within the next few days...

Also came with an anchor, Humminbird fishfinder and Raytheon VHF to boot!
